jQuery Datatables integration for Django
Project description
Easy integration between jQuery DataTables and Django.
Compatibility
Django ezTables requires Python 2.7, Django 1.4 and Django.js 0.5.
Installation
You can install Django ezTables with pip:
$ pip install django-eztables
or with easy_install:
$ easy_install django-eztables
Add djangojs and django-eztables to your settings.INSTALLED_APPS.
Features
- Datatables.net, plugins and localization integration with Django.
- Server-side processing with a simple view supporting:
- sorting (single and multi columns)
- filtering with regex support (global and by column)
- formatting using format pattern
- Deferred loading support.
- Twitter Bootstrap integration.
Demo
You can try the demo by cloning this repository and running the test server with provided data:
$ python manage.py syncdb $ python manage.py loaddata eztables/demo/fixtures/browsers.json $ pyhton manage.py runserver
Then open your browser to http://localhost:8000
Documentation
The documentation is hosted on Read the Docs
Changelog
0.2.1 (2013-02-08)
- Fix formatting with unicode
0.2 (2013-02-07)
- Handle custom server-side search implementation
- Handle custom server-side sort implementation
0.1.2 (2013-02-07)
- Fix static files packaging
0.1.1 (2013-02-07)
- Fix requirements packaging
0.1 (2013-02-07)
- Initial implementation
Project details
Download files
Download the file for your platform. If you're not sure which to choose, learn more about installing packages.
Filename, size | File type | Python version | Upload date | Hashes |
---|---|---|---|---|
Filename, size django-eztables-0.2.1.tar.gz (152.9 kB) | File type Source | Python version None | Upload date | Hashes View |